| Obverse description | The fourth definitive effigy of Queen Elizabeth II, as modelled by Ian Rank-Broadley, depicted in right-facing profile wearing the Girls of Great Britain and Ireland Tiara. The queen's truncation bears the initials IRB. The surrounding legend reads ELIZABETH II AUSTRALIA 2019, with the denomination implied by the reverse inscription. |

| Reverse description | A stylised depiction of the fictional Ramsay Street sign, as featured in the long-running Australian television series Neighbours, rendered in a bold graphic design. The letter N appears prominently in the lower central field, representing the fourteenth entry in the Great Aussie Coin Hunt series. The legends ONE DOLLAR and NEIGHBOURS appear within the design, identifying the denomination and the cultural reference. The overall composition reflects the popular culture theme of the series, with clean lines suited to the proof finish. |
